The latest updates also reflect how there is still progress happening at Hamilton Park Pacesetter Magnet. For example, the district acknowledged their Teachers of the Year for the 2025-2026 year. Parents have been invited to see what the Leadership Magnet of this school does and learn about how it encourages good study habits and organizational skills. The voters within the Richardson ISD area voted to approve a large bond for 2025 that will fund improvements.
Q1. Does the school offer gifted and talented programs?
Ans. Yes, the campus offers gifted and talented programming, which is intended to engage gifted students with higher-level instruction, reasoning, and project learning.
Q2. What extracurricular activities does the school offer?
Ans. Extracurricular activities include academic enrichment, robotics programs, visual arts, music, and any other activities that encourage teamwork.
Q3. Do you have transportation for magnet students?
Ans. If the students meet certain requirements, they may have transportation arranged under certain conditions set forth by Richardson ISD.
Q4. How do we enroll into the magnet program?
Ans. Application will be required to gain access to the magnet program during the district's magnet enrollment period.
Q5. Does the campus offer special accommodations to meet diverse academic requirements?
Ans. The campus offers various academic interventions and resources to meet diverse academic needs of students.
